ERA 2026 in Glasgow: International Exchange Driving the Future of Nephrology

The ERA Congress 2026 in Glasgow once again underscored its role as one of the leading international platforms for scientific exchange in nephrology. With a record attendance of 10,670 participants, this year's congress brought together experts from academia, clinical practice, and industry from around the world.

For the MEDICE Health Family, the congress provided a valuable opportunity to discuss the latest developments in kidney care, strengthen international relationships, and gain new insights for the future of patient care. At the heart of the event were meaningful exchanges with healthcare professionals and discussions about innovative approaches in nephrology.

The scientific programme also attracted considerable interest. Highlights included a “Meet the Expert” session with Prof. Philip Kalra and the MEDICE Industry Symposium, which focused on current developments in the management of renal anaemia in dialysis care. Renowned international experts shared the latest scientific findings and clinical perspectives, providing valuable insights for everyday practice.
